About

GE Vernova Inc., an energy company, engages in the provision of various products and services that generate, transfer, orchestrate, convert, and store electricity in the United States, Europe, Asia, the Middle East, and Africa. The company operates through three segments: Power, Wind, and Electrification. The Power segment designs, manufactures, and services gas, nuclear, hydro, and steam technol… Read more

G2EV34 (G2EV34)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of December 2025: R$11.18 Billion BRL

Based on the latest financial reports, G2EV34 (G2EV34) has net assets worth R$11.18 Billion BRL as of December 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(R$63.02 Billion) and total liabilities (R$51.84 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.

Equity Growth Attribution

This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in G2EV34's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.

Equity Growth Insights

  • From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 9,546,000,000 to 11,178,000,000, a change of 1,632,000,000 (17.1%).
  • Net income of 4,883,000,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
  • Dividend payments of 275,000,000 reduced retained earnings.
  • Share repurchases of 3,316,000,000 reduced equity.
  • Other factors increased equity by 340,000,000.
